    Smile So happy, new python just ate for me!

    I am so thrilled. Seems kinds silly really to be so excited, but I am!
    My juvi ball python that I got last Thursday just ate for me! She had been coming out of her hide more the past two days and I thought she might be looking around for food. So I thawed a fuzzy, warmed it up, and sat it ontop of the screen so Eileithiya (Ili) could start to smell it.
    About an hour later I put the fuzzy in some tongs and started dangling it infront of Ili, jiggling it a bit, and she looked interested. Started tonguing the air, coiling her upper body, and within a minute or two, she struck and grabbed it. I let go and proceeded to watch her swallow it! Now she seems to be looking around for more. Could that be? She keeps coming back to the area of her home where she grabbed the fuzzy. Should I offer her more than one fuzzy per feeding?
    I can hardly explain how happy and blessed I feel that she ate on our first attempt since bringing her home. Yeah!!!
